  • 1. Take 8 ounces of orange juice (reduced sugar variety or use 4 ounces of OJ and 4ounces of water, plus a Splenda)
    2. 1 banana
    3. 1 scoop soy protein power
    4. 1 cup frozen blueberries
    Blend for 30 seconds. Makes 2 full smoothies. Save one for an afternoon snack

    1 container fat-free flavored yogurt (such as Dannon Light n Fit)
    Handful of ice
    Some OJ
    Handful of berries and half a banana
    Put all in blender and blend. If your blender is weak, you may need to crush the ice first.
    Experiment with the quantities of juice and ice that you need to get the smoothie to your desired consistency. Watch the calories in the OJ though, it can sneak up on you if you put too much in. If you want more protein, try adding half of a scoop of Lean Dessert protein powder, vanilla flavor (you can find it on Amazon).
    OR – you could just get the protein powder and make smoothies out of that (the instructions are on the container), just requires ice, milk and the protein powder…but I add fruit as well.
